Overview
An annual two-day Symposium on the topic of Child Maltreatment provided by the Child Abuse Pediatrics Division at Ann & Robert H. Lurie Children's Hospital of Chicago. The purpose of the Symposium is to bring awareness to the different aspects of child abuse and neglect to a diverse audience to help educate individuals that work on child abuse and neglect cases. The Child Maltreatment Symposium will consist of 9 lecturers that will present on topics associated with sub-populations within the field of child maltreatment and on wellness for providers. At this year's Symposium, the Division of Child Abuse Pediatrics will collaborate in-person and virtually with experts within the field of pediatric medicine, law enforcement, social work, and other members that work within the fi eld to combat child abuse and neglect.

Objectives
  1. Identify and compare strategies for screening and inquiry for Intimate partner violence in the pediatric setting
  2. Identify ways to support caregivers in pediatric care settings
  3. Define the basic concept of epigenetics
  4. Describe the role of epigenetics in mediating the relationship between early life experiences and health outcomes
  5. Describe an expanded scope of child trafficking and exploitation
  6. Discuss that a true multi-disciplined approach to a medical child abuse investigation is needed to successfully protect the victim and bring justice to the offender
  7. Recognize the clinical and historical features of abusive head trauma
  8. Discuss the effects of psychological maltreatment on child development
  9. Identify the different challenges experienced by non-English speaking immigrant families when discussing child maltreatment topics.
